Who is Sheikha Mahra? Facts to know about the Dubai Princess

She is rumoured to be dating French Montana.
Sheikha Mahra recently sparked dating rumours after she was spotted with Moroccan-American rapper French Montana. Here are interesting things you may not know about the Dubai Princess.

Related Posts

Leave a Reply

Your email address will not be published.